Kimberly-Clark Dividend - Frequently Asked Questions

What is Kimberly-Clark's dividend yield?

The current dividend yield for Kimberly-Clark is 3.25%. Learn more on KMB's dividend yield history.

How much is Kimberly-Clark's annual dividend?

The annual dividend for KMB shares is $4.72. Learn more on KMB's annual dividend history.

How often does Kimberly-Clark pay dividends?

Kimberly-Clark pays quarterly dividends to shareholders.

When is Kimberly-Clark's next dividend payment?

Kimberly-Clark's next quarterly dividend payment of $1.18 per share will be made to shareholders on Wednesday, July 5, 2023.

When was Kimberly-Clark's most recent dividend payment?

Kimberly-Clark's most recent quarterly dividend payment of $1.18 per share was made to shareholders on Tuesday, April 4, 2023.

When is Kimberly-Clark's ex-dividend date?

Kimberly-Clark's next ex-dividend date is Thursday, June 8, 2023.

When was Kimberly-Clark's most recent ex-dividend date?

Kimberly-Clark's most recent ex-dividend date was Thursday, March 9, 2023.

Is Kimberly-Clark's dividend growing?

Over the past three years, the company's dividend has grown by an average of 4.04% per year.

What track record does Kimberly-Clark have of raising its dividend?

Kimberly-Clark has increased its dividend for the past 52 consecutive years.

When did Kimberly-Clark last increase or decrease its dividend?

The most recent change in the company's dividend was an increase of $0.02 on Wednesday, January 25, 2023.

What is Kimberly-Clark's dividend payout ratio?
The dividend payout ratio for KMB is:
  • 80.82% based on the trailing year of earnings
  • 76.25% based on this year's estimates
  • 67.72% based on next year's estimates
  • 59.92% based on cash flow
